Minutes — Management Meeting, Tarnwell Software

Attendees: branch managers plus head office (Reisel, Okonde, Faber).

Topic: migration from monthly to annual billing. Agreed approach: new customers default to annual from the first of next quarter; existing customers offered a 10% incentive to convert at renewal. Branches must track conversion objections carefully and report patterns monthly. Faber will circulate revised invoicing templates. Expected cash-flow benefit was discussed at length, and the underlying plan is set out below.

confidential, kagup-bafog: Fraaxax Group is in early talks to buy Soroxox Group for about $343.8 million. The Olidor launch date is June 14, and nothing goes to the press before then. Legal wants the Aldmirek Logistics term sheet signed before July 23.

## Escalation — Chirpline log sampling

If Chirpline's sampled log volume still exceeds quota after lowering the sample rate to 1%, do not disable logging outright; downstream billing audits depend on the retained stream. Instead, enable the burst-suppression filter and open a capacity ticket. If the quota breach persists past one hour, escalate by writing to the observability duty inbox.

alerts address for kajef-hadug: istys@zemvarnet.local

# Tilegrove Environments

Tilegrove's cache layer sits between the renderer and the map storage cluster. Three environments exist: dev (shared, small cache, aggressive eviction), staging (production-sized, synthetic traffic replay), and prod (regional shards in Northreach and Calder Bay). Eviction tuning changes must land in staging for at least two days before promotion. Staging currently runs with the following values:

deployment values, tajep-fahag:
ulaath:
  pin: 7600
  metrics_host: metrics.ulaath.zemvarlabs.internal
  tenant: drueth
  seal: seal_5c905fe9

Ticket CFG-318: Hot-reload drops overrides on Brindlegate workers

Heads up for the eng sync: when we push a config change, Brindlegate workers reload fine the first time, but the second reload within five minutes silently reverts tenant overrides to defaults. Looks like the watcher debounce swallows the delta file. Easy to repro in staging, annoying to catch in prod because metrics still look green. I bisected it down to the build stamped right below.

pipeline stamp: htk9_ce63042d9